Otex ear drops are used to help remove hardened wax from the ear canal. Otex is suitable for use by adults, children and the elderly. The active ingredient is urea hydrogen peroxide. It works by breaking down the ear wax into small pieces.Does Earex unblock ears?

Otex Ear Drops are used to help soften earwax to help ease hearing difficulties and pain caused by a an excess of hardened wax. Otex contains the active ingredient urea hydrogen peroxide. This ingredient works by releasing oxygen, which breaks up hardened earwax.How do I know if Otex is working?
When you first put a few drops in your ears you wont feel anything, a few seconds later you will hear/feel some fizzing and then it will start bubbling. The bubbling can be a little uncomfortable but that's how you know it's working!How do you clean your ears after Earex?

Ear drops alone will clear a plug of earwax in most cases. Put 2 or 3 drops of ordinary olive oil down the ear 2 or 3 times a day for 2-3 weeks. This softens the wax so that it then runs out of its own accord without harming the ear. You can continue for any length of time, but 3 weeks is usually enough.What to do when you have blocked ears?
If your ears are plugged, try swallowing, yawning or chewing sugar-free gum to open your eustachian tubes. If this doesn't work, take a deep breath and try to blow out of your nose gently while pinching your nostrils closed and keeping your mouth shut. If you hear a popping noise, you know you have succeeded.Why does my ear feel blocked but no wax?

If you need to clear earwax from your ear canal, a few drops of mineral oil or baby oil usually does the trick. Put a few drops in one ear, allow it to soak for about five minutes, then, tilt your head to remove the oil.Why do I have so much earwax all of a sudden?
A: Ear wax production is often triggered by what hearing health care professionals call a contact stimulus. Objects like headphones, earbuds and even hearing aids that contact and rub the ears are the biggest culprits. By producing more earwax, your ears are trying to protect themselves from irritation or infection.How do candles remove ear wax?
